Deep dive: coverage
Clarity connects your checking account, 401(k), Coinbase portfolio, and Ethereum DeFi positions in a single net worth view. Simplifi stops at banks and brokerages — there is no crypto exchange syncing and no on-chain wallet support.

Deep dive: coverage
Simplifi connects to banks, credit cards, loans, and investment accounts through Quicken's aggregation infrastructure. It shows investment balances and basic allocation but does not support crypto exchanges, on-chain wallets, or DeFi protocols.

Deep dive: pricingPredictability
Simplifi is $72/year with no tiers — a genuinely good deal for a budgeting app. It covers banks, credit cards, loans, and basic investment balances. The gap is crypto, DeFi, portfolio analytics, and AI-powered insights, none of which Simplifi offers at any price.

Deep dive: dataFreshness
Simplifi syncs bank data on a regular schedule, but investment prices can lag behind real-time market data by several hours. There is no crypto or on-chain data to refresh.

Deep dive: exportReporting
Simplifi offers spending reports and a 12-month cash flow projection but lacks CSV export and detailed portfolio performance reports.

FAQ: Does Clarity have a spending plan like Simplifi?
Clarity offers budgeting and spending analysis with AI-powered categorization rather than Simplifi's auto-adjusting spending plan. Both help you understand where your money goes, but the approach is different — Clarity focuses on automated insights while Simplifi focuses on a daily spending target.

FAQ: Is Clarity more expensive than Simplifi?
Simplifi costs $72/year. Clarity's annual plan is $99/year but includes crypto tracking, DeFi wallets, AI categorization, market data, and tax reports that Simplifi does not offer. The price difference buys significantly broader coverage.
